Spontaneous isolated inferior mesenteric artery dissection.

Zhijun Mei1, Junmin Bao, Zaiping Jing

  • 1Department of Vascular Surgery, Changhai Hospital, Second Military Medical University, Shanghai, China. 13386273986@189.cn

Abdominal Imaging
|November 6, 2010
PubMed
Summary

This case report details the first known instance of spontaneous isolated inferior mesenteric artery (IMA) dissection. Early diagnosis using CT scans is crucial for managing acute abdominal pain caused by IMA dissection.

Area of Science:

  • Vascular Surgery
  • Gastroenterology
  • Radiology

Background:

  • Spontaneous arterial dissection is a rare condition.
  • The inferior mesenteric artery (IMA) is an uncommon site for spontaneous dissection.
  • Acute abdominal pain can have diverse etiologies, requiring thorough differential diagnosis.

Observation:

  • A 58-year-old female presented with acute left lower abdominal pain.
  • CT angiography revealed proximal IMA dilation, distal occlusion, and peri-arterial edema.
  • Laparotomy confirmed IMA dissection with secondary thrombosis.

Findings:

  • This is the first reported case of spontaneous isolated IMA dissection.
  • Surgical intervention included thrombectomy, intimal flap resection, and autogenous vein patch reconstruction.
  • Successful arterial reconstruction was achieved.

Implications:

  • Isolated IMA dissection should be considered in the differential diagnosis of acute abdomen.
  • Radiological findings like arterial dilation, occlusion, and peri-arterial edema are key indicators.
  • High-resolution CT can aid in diagnosing IMA dissection by visualizing intimal flaps and double lumens.
